Journal of Business Studies and Management Review
Published by Universitas Jambi
ISSN : 2597369X     EISSN : 25976265     DOI : https://doi.org/10.22437/jbsmr
Core Subject : Science, Social,
The aim of the Journal of Business Studies and Management Review (JBSMR)  is to be a unique journal in its provision of extraordinary services like quick and professional correspondence with authors, fair and comprehensive articles’ double-blind peer review, prompt results of reviews by our dedicated reviewers and editors, high readership and impact. The scope of the manuscript that can be published in JBSMR is financial management, human resource management, marketing management, production and operation management, retail, e-retail, e-commerce, entrepreneurship, small and medium enterprises, and digital marketing in any Business and Management Discipline.

RISK MANAGEMENT AND EARNINGS MANAGEMENT ON FINANCIAL PERFORMANCE IN ISLAMIC BANKING: AN EMPIRICAL STUDY OF INDONESIA Oki Sania Riski; Rika Lidyah; Titin Hartini

Abstract

This study aims to determine the effect of risk management and earnings management on financial performances in Islamic banking: an empirical study of Indonesia. This study uses a quantitative research method. As for the sampling technique, we used purposive sampling. The type of data is secondary data. The samples used in this study were ten banks registered with the Financial Services Authority from 2015 to 2020. Data analysis in this study used the application of the SEM-PLS. This research indicates that risk management and earnings management affect financial performance. Keywords: Risk Management, Earnings Management, Financial Performance.

Abstract

The purpose of this study was to test the capital market's reaction to the announcement of an increase in fuel prices on the composite stock price index through testing differences in returns and trading volume before and after the fuel price increase on September 3, 2022. This research uses an event study approach, the sample in this study is the stock price index. combination during the event period. The results of this study show that the capital market reacted to the fuel price hike event on September 3, 2022. There are differences in market returns and trading volume on the composite stock price index before and after the fuel price increase, which indicates that the fuel price increase has an influence on market movements capital in Indonesia, this is due to the significant increase in fuel prices at the time of the observation event

Abstract

In recent years, e-commerce in Indonesia is growing rapidly which makes the level of competition between e-commerce is also high and has resulted in the closure of several e-commerce because they are unable to compete. It can be said that live streaming is one of the innovations as a marketing strategy for new e-commerce. To avoid suspicions of different product characteristics photos, fake shops, fraudulent sellers and others and to increase customer trust, Tokopedia Play created a live shopping experience feature. And can increase customer engagement which ultimately consumers buy and revisit. This study aims to examine the effect of live streaming, customer trust, and customer engagement in making online purchases on Tokopedia e-commerce. The independent variable in this study is live streaming. The dependent variable is customer engagement. And the intervening variable is customer trust. Respondents in this study were people who had shopped online through live streaming on Tokopedia Play. This study uses quantitative research methods and PLS analysis. Using a minimum of 105 respondents. The results of the study show that: (1) Live streaming has a positive and significant effect on customer trust. (2) Customer trust has a positive and significant effect on customer engagement. (3) The effect of live streaming on customer trust and on customer engagement is significant and positive.

Abstract

Indonesia is an archipelago where ferry transportation is a means of transportation that is often used by the community, which acts as a bridge between islands separated by waters. Ujung-Kamal Port is a crossing that connects Java Island with Madura Island. Since the construction of the Suramadu Bridge in 2009 and the elimination of the entrance fee, the number of passengers in the crossing has decreased. This study aims to determine the effect of 3 research variables namely comfort, safety and reliability which represent indicators of service quality on passenger loyalty for crossing transportation across Ujung-Kamal. This research uses quantitative descriptive method with the determination of respondents using simple random sampling method and for data analysis using SEM PLS application. The SEM PLS application is used to measure the relationship between variables with measuring indicators and to determine the relationship between the independent variable and the dependent variable. Based on the results of the study, it shows that the variables of comfort, safety and reliability have an influence on passenger loyalty across the Ujung-Kamal crossing.

Abstract

Abstract The purpose of this study is to analyze strategies for improving the financial performance of Culinary MSMEs in the current era and after the Covid-19 pandemic in Jambi City. The analysis tools used are SWOT analysis and PLS analysis. The results showed that the SO (Strenght Opportunity) Strategy increased customer trust, added employees, and maintained cleanliness. The WO (Weaknesses Opportunity) strategy provides discounts on every purchase, providing free order delivery services at short distances. Strategy ST (Strenght Threat) adding new employees, decorating the room so that visitors are comfortable. The WT (Weaknesses Threat) strategy is adding new products or adding level variants to old products, looking for new investors to expand the business. Then Entrepreneur Orientation has a significant effect on innovation in Culinary MSMEs in Jambi City, Market Orientation has no significant effect on innovation in Culinary MSMEs in Jambi City, Entrepreneur Orientation has a significant effect on Financial Performance on Culinary MSMEs in Jambi City, Market Orientation has no significant effect on Financial Performance on Culinary MSMEs in Jambi City, Innovation has a significant effect on Financial Performance on Culinary MSMEs in Jambi City, Entrepreneurial Orientation has a significant effect on MSME Financial Performance with innovation as a mediating variable on Culinary MSMEs in Jambi City, Market Orientation has a significant effect on MSME Financial Performance with innovation as a mediating variable in Culinary MSMEs in Jambi City.
